About

In recent decades, authors affiliated with Saitama Institute of Technology have published 1.5k papers, which have received a total of 17.3k indexed citations. Scholars at this organization have produced 351 papers in Electrical and Electronic Engineering, 323 papers in Materials Chemistry and 227 papers in Mechanical Engineering on the topics of Electrochemical sensors and biosensors (129 papers), Electrochemical Analysis and Applications (106 papers) and Black Holes and Theoretical Physics (86 papers). Their work is cited by papers focused on Materials Chemistry (4.5k citations), Electrical and Electronic Engineering (4.2k citations) and Mechanical Engineering (2.2k citations). Authors at Saitama Institute of Technology collaborate with scholars in Japan, China and United States and have published in prestigious journals including Physical Review Letters, Journal of the American Chemical Society and The Journal of Chemical Physics. Some of Saitama Institute of Technology's most productive authors include Tomohiro Matsuda, Ken‐ichi Tanaka, Yasushi Hasebe, Shunichi Uchiyama, Hong He, Changbin Zhang, Masaki Satoh, Tadashi Narita, Meguru Tezuka and Satoru Ishizuka.
